虚拟kvm软件,深入探索KVM虚拟化技术,免费KVM服务器虚拟化解决方案详解
- 综合资讯
- 2024-12-13 17:18:03
- 2

本文深入解析虚拟KVM软件,全面探讨KVM虚拟化技术,并详细介绍免费KVM服务器虚拟化解决方案,为读者提供全面的技术指导。...
本文深入解析虚拟KVM软件,全面探讨KVM虚拟化技术,并详细介绍免费KVM服务器虚拟化解决方案,为读者提供全面的技术指导。
随着云计算的快速发展,虚拟化技术已成为数据中心建设的重要手段,KVM(Kernel-based Virtual Machine)作为一种开源的虚拟化技术,凭借其高效、稳定、易用的特点,在服务器虚拟化领域得到了广泛应用,本文将深入探讨KVM虚拟化技术,并详细介绍一款免费KVM服务器虚拟化解决方案。
KVM虚拟化技术简介
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它将虚拟化功能集成到操作系统内核中,实现了高效、稳定的虚拟化体验,与传统的虚拟化技术相比,KVM具有以下优势:
1、高效:KVM利用Linux内核进行虚拟化,无需额外的硬件支持,大大降低了资源消耗,提高了虚拟机的性能。
2、稳定:KVM采用内核模块的方式实现虚拟化,保证了内核的稳定性和安全性。
3、易用:KVM提供丰富的API和工具,方便用户进行虚拟化资源的配置和管理。
4、开源:KVM作为开源项目,用户可以自由地获取源代码,进行二次开发和定制。
免费KVM服务器虚拟化解决方案
市面上有许多免费的KVM服务器虚拟化解决方案,以下将介绍一款具有代表性的免费KVM服务器虚拟化软件——Proxmox VE。
1、Proxmox VE简介
Proxmox VE是一款基于Debian的虚拟化解决方案,它将KVM和LXC(Linux Container)集成在一起,提供了一站式的虚拟化体验,Proxmox VE具有以下特点:
(1)支持KVM和LXC两种虚拟化技术,满足不同场景的需求。
(2)提供图形化界面和命令行工具,方便用户进行虚拟化资源的配置和管理。
(3)支持集群功能,实现虚拟机的负载均衡和高可用。
(4)提供丰富的插件和模块,扩展虚拟化功能。
2、安装Proxmox VE
以下是安装Proxmox VE的步骤:
(1)下载Proxmox VE安装镜像:访问Proxmox VE官网(https://www.proxmox.com/),下载适用于您的服务器的安装镜像。
(2)制作安装U盘:使用工具如Rufus将安装镜像写入U盘。
(3)启动服务器:将U盘插入服务器,重启服务器并从U盘启动。
(4)按照提示进行安装:在安装过程中,选择合适的安装选项,如存储位置、网络配置等。
(5)安装完成后,重启服务器,使用用户名“root”和设置的密码登录Proxmox VE管理界面。
3、配置KVM虚拟机
以下是配置KVM虚拟机的步骤:
(1)登录Proxmox VE管理界面:使用浏览器访问服务器IP地址,登录Proxmox VE管理界面。
(2)创建虚拟机:在左侧菜单中选择“虚拟机”->“添加虚拟机”,按照提示填写虚拟机名称、CPU核心数、内存大小等信息。
(3)选择存储类型:根据需要选择存储类型,如本地存储、iSCSI存储等。
(4)设置网络:配置虚拟机的网络,可以选择桥接、NAT等模式。
(5)安装操作系统:将操作系统镜像文件上传到Proxmox VE,然后选择虚拟机并启动,按照提示安装操作系统。
4、管理虚拟机
Proxmox VE提供丰富的管理功能,以下是部分常用功能:
(1)克隆虚拟机:可以将现有虚拟机克隆成新的虚拟机,方便快速部署。
(2)迁移虚拟机:可以将虚拟机从一个服务器迁移到另一个服务器,实现负载均衡和高可用。
(3)监控虚拟机:实时监控虚拟机的CPU、内存、磁盘等资源使用情况。
(4)备份与恢复:对虚拟机进行备份和恢复,保证数据安全。
免费KVM服务器虚拟化解决方案为企业和个人提供了高效、稳定、易用的虚拟化体验,本文以Proxmox VE为例,详细介绍了KVM虚拟化技术及其配置方法,希望本文对您了解和使用KVM虚拟化技术有所帮助。
本文链接:https://zhitaoyun.cn/1534835.html
发表评论